Why resistor should disconnected from the circuit when measured the value of resistor?

if not disconnected you will measure the resistance of the circuit in parallel with the resistor.


What is it called when a circuit has gaps or breaks?

It is called an open, incomplete, or broken circuit. Circuits might be opened intentionally (using a switch), or unintentionally (breaks in, or disconnected wiring).


What is the kind of circuit in which an electrical load may be disconnected without affecting other loads?

In a parallel circuit an electrical load may be disconnected without affecting other loads.

If a wire on a series circuit is disconnected what will happen to the two lights?

If a wire on a series circuit is disconnected, both lights will go out. In a series circuit, current flows through each component in sequence, so if the circuit is broken by disconnecting a wire, the current cannot flow through either light.
